A preferred option will be selected in 2023.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">According to Deputy prime minister Grant Robertson: &#8220;Auckland\u2019s population is projected to rise to two million by early next decade. In order to move two million people around our largest city safely and efficiently, we need well-planned and connected infrastructure.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">&#8220;We have deliberately chosen this option for Auckland Light Rail that will integrate with other major infrastructure projects across Auckland, like the additional Waitemat\u0101 Harbour crossing, the Auckland Rapid Transit Plan, and K\u0101inga Ora Large Scale Projects,&#8221; added Robertson.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">Minister of transport Michael Wood asserted: &#8220;Alongside the City Rail Link, the underground network will bring Aucklanders transport infrastructure into the 21st century, allowing faster trips and reduced emissions.
